Autonomous scrubbers account for approximately 48% of the market, with production exceeding 580,000 units in 2025. These robots offer cleaning capacities of 1,500–3,500 square meters per hour and feature water tank capacities ranging from 20–80 liters. Equipped with LiDAR and ultrasonic sensors, they achieve navigation accuracy of over 95%.

Their ability to perform wet cleaning operations and remove stubborn dirt makes them ideal for commercial and industrial applications. Adoption rates in retail and logistics sectors exceed 50%, driven by efficiency improvements of up to 35%. Autonomous scrubbers continue to dominate due to their superior cleaning capabilities and technological advancements.

Robotic vacuum cleaners hold a 32% market share, with annual production volumes reaching 390,000 units. These systems are designed for dry cleaning and operate at speeds of 0.5–1.5 meters per second, covering areas up to 2,000 square meters per hour.

They are widely used in office spaces and healthcare facilities, with penetration rates of 40% and 30%, respectively. Advanced filtration systems capture up to 99.5% of dust particles, enhancing air quality. Their cost-effectiveness and ease of deployment contribute to their growing adoption.

Hybrid cleaning robots represent 20% of the market, combining vacuuming and scrubbing functionalities. Production volumes reached 240,000 units in 2025, with capabilities to clean 2,500–4,000 square meters per hour.

These robots are increasingly adopted in large-scale facilities, offering versatility and operational efficiency. Their ability to switch between cleaning modes reduces operational costs by up to 25%, making them a preferred choice for multi-functional environments.

Commercial facilities account for 46% of the market, with over 550,000 units deployed across malls, airports, and offices. Robots in this segment operate 3–5 cycles per day, improving cleanliness standards and reducing labor costs by 30%.

High adoption rates in retail chains, exceeding 48%, drive demand, supported by increasing foot traffic and hygiene requirements.

Industrial facilities contribute 34% of the market, with approximately 410,000 units deployed. Robots in this segment handle large areas exceeding 10,000 square meters and operate continuously for 8–10 hours.

Integration with warehouse systems enhances efficiency, reducing cleaning time by 25%.

Healthcare facilities hold 20% share, with 260,000 units deployed. Robots equipped with UV-C technology improve disinfection efficiency by 40%, supporting infection control measures.
